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- Whether the proposal would be inappropriate development in the Green Belt having regard to the Framework and any relevant development plan policies
- The effect of the proposal on the openness of the Green Belt
- Whether any harm by reason of inappropriateness, and any other harm, would be clearly outweighed by other considerations, so as to amount to the very special circumstances required to justify the proposal
What decided it
The proposal would cause substantial harm to Green Belt openness and conflict with its purposes, and the modest weight afforded to the appellant's accessibility and safety concerns was insufficient to outweigh this harm and establish very special circumstances.
